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| アオムネカワセミ | Desmarest's hutia |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(動物) | Animalia (動物)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(脊索動物) | Chordata (脊索動物) |
| Class | Aves (鳥類) | Mammalia (哺乳類) |
| Order | Coraciiformes (ブッポウソウ目) | Rodentia (ネズミ目) |
| Family | Alcedinidae | Capromyidae |
| Genus | Alcedo | Capromys |
| Species | Alcedo euryzona | Capromys pilorides |
Evolutionary Relationship
アオムネカワセミ and Desmarest's hutia share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(脊索動物)
